Frequently Asked Questions about Alameda

How much are Studio apartments in Alameda?

There are currently 1,920 Studio Apartments in Alameda with rent ranges from $765 to $5,210 with an average price of $5,188.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Alameda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Alameda ranges from $800 to $11,870 with an average monthly rent of $2,593.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Alameda c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Alameda range from $1,749 to $7,913.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,336.

How expensive are Alameda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 576 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Alameda on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,895 to $15,030 - averaging $4,211 for the location.
